Feyenoord reject Liverpool’s opening €9m offer for Arne Slot despite positive talks

According to The Athletic, Feyenoord have rejected Liverpool’s opening offer for head coach Arne Slot after the Premier League side made the Dutchman their preferred choice to succeed Jürgen Klopp. The Reds pursuit of Slot kicked off earlier this week after the 45-year-old head coach helped guide Feyenoord to their 14th KNVB Cup, beating NEC Nijmegen 1-0 in Sunday’s final.

Liverpool have had a €9m offer rejected by Feyenoord, although they remain in direct contact with Arne Slot who is said to be enthusiastic about the possibility of taking over at Anfield this summer. The Reds still have eyes on other targets, although Slot is their number one target.

Slot spent his entire playing career in the Netherlands, featuring in midfield for PEC Zwolle, NAC Breda and Sparta Rotterdam. After hanging up his boots in 2013 at PEC Zwolle, Slot took up coaching roles at the club before being appointed as an assistant coach at Cambuur. In 2017, he joined AZ Alkmaar, initially working as an assistant before being appointed as head coach two years later. The Eredivisie was cancelled during his first season in charge due to Covid, but Slot guided the club to second place, level on points with Ajax.

Feyenoord came calling in 2021, and over the last three years Arne Slot has transformed them into a powerhouse in European football. Now, he appears to be keen on the Liverpool job. The Premier League giants are already discussing contract terms and as long as they reach an agreement with Feyenoord over a fee, things look set to progress.
